1.13.3 Removal of Horizontal Blade
Warning
Be sure to wait 10 minutes or more after turning off all power supplies before disassembling work.
Procedure:
Step
1
Gently bend the support
plate located at the
center of the horizontal
blade, and detach the
center shaft.
(Two shafts provided
on Types 140 and
160.)
2
Then gently bend the
center of the horizontal
blade, and take both the
end shafts out of their
bearings.
Reassembling precautions
1
The shaft at the right end
of the horizontal blade is
cut in D shape. Fit this
D-shaped end to the
D-profiled bearing.
Reattach the horizontal
blade at the right side
first.

Points
When removing the horizontal
blade from the bearings at
both ends, be careful not to
get the blow port thermal
insulation scratched.
